Understanding Computer Monitor (32-inch) Energy Costs in Syracuse, NY

Syracuse is a mid-sized New York city where residential electricity rates from National Grid are shaped by regional energy supply and local demand patterns. Running a low-draw appliance like the Computer Monitor (32-inch) (45W) at Syracuse's rate of 24.1¢/kWh costs approximately $26 per year — $12 more than the national average of $14.

Electricity in Syracuse is significantly more expensive than the national average — 85% higher. For a Computer Monitor (32-inch) used 8 hours per day, this rate premium adds up to $12 in extra annual costs. Energy-efficient models and usage habits have an outsized impact in high-rate markets like this.
